Costa Madora (Madorian: Republika Kosta Madora), formally Republic of Costa Madora, is an island nation located west of Krosari in Ferlanic Ocean. It borders Geuvaria to the north, and controls the Bellefait and Canbuttu Isles. As of 2020, Costa Madora has an estimated population of 9.3 million. The capital and largest city is Vitorife, other major cities are Lincamento and San Monica. Costa Madora’s official language is Madorian.
Costa Madora has been ranked favourably in human rights, political freedom, civil liberties, press and internet freedom. Costa Madora is one of the founding nations of the Krosarian Union, member of NFTO, Belaire Agreement, founder of NOCI, and part of the North Ferlanic Banks union.
Since prehistoric times, the territory of the Republic of Costa Madora has been inhabited by various tribes, who emerged in history as the Alosakian Confederation. Following this period, the confederation was threatened by the rapidly growing Barborican Empire, who colonized southeast Costa Madora. During the Barborican-Alosakian War, Barborico annexed the Alosakian Confederation. In 1318, the independent Kingdom of Costa Madora was established, later expanding under Catherine I as the Madorian Empire. In 1844, the November Revolution overthrew the Crown, leading to the short-lived Republic of Costa Madora. Under Catherine II, the Kingdom of Costa Madora was restored, later replaced by the current Republic of Costa Madora. Since then, Costa Madora has maintained the policy of neutrality, albeit the nation has participated in the Esta Maustanian wars against crime.
